My caterer suggested putting simply, "RSVP, regrets only" with a telephone number on the actual wedding invitation. Is this ok? He suggested this instead of the separate reply cards. We are having the reception to follow the ceremony at same location. I was told by my wedding coordinator that this was not proper to have the RSVP and telephone number printed directly on the invitation.

An RSVP may be printed with an address on the invitations if these are also reception invitations, which it seems to be in your case. But, we don't list a phone number. If your wedding is very informal, it would be fine. I doubt that yours is informal if you have a caterer and a wedding coordinator though.

This used to be the norm before response cards. Guests knew how to write formal replies, but the art seems lost to most today.

I agree that I would reserve this for only the most informal of weddings, and even then, only include it on a separate reception card.
